Discussion:
The problem looks complicated until you realize the term n^-4 appears in both the numerator and denominator. Hence their quotient is 1. That is,
n ^(-4) / ( 3 * n^(-4)) =
(n ^(-4) / n^(-4) ) * (1/3) =
1 * (1/3) =
1/3

Given the line y-1 = 1(x+2), in order to know the line that is perpendicular to the given line, we will first find the slope of the known line.
The standard form of equation of a line is expressed as y = mx+c
m is the slope
c is the intercept
Rewrite the equation given
y-1 = 1(x+2)
y-1 = x+2
y = x+2+1
y = x+3
Comparing to the standard form, the slope m = 1.
For two lines to be perpendicular, the product of their slope must be -1 i.e mM = -1
Substitute
1(M) = -1
M = -1
For us to know the line that is perpendicular to the given line, its slope must be -1.
<em>Since none of the equation has a slope of -1, hence none of the lines are perpendicular to the line y - 1= 1(x+2).</em>
